AirPods Pro 2 Available for All-Time Low Price of $197.99 Ahead of Black Friday [Update: Sold Out]

Apple's AirPods Pro 2 headphones have dropped to a new all-time low price of $197.99 on Woot, down from $249.00. The AirPods Pro 2 are in brand new condition on Woot and as of writing they're in stock and ready to ship.

With this discount, the AirPods Pro 2 have now reached the lowest price point they've ever seen following their release in September. Woot's sale has been automatically applied so you don't need any coupon code or have to wait until checkout to see the discount.

The AirPods Pro 2 are similar in design to the original AirPods Pro, featuring a rounded design with silicone ear tips and a short stem. Apple added the H2 chip that enables new capabilities, including improved Active Noise Cancellation and and update to Transparency mode with an Adaptive Transparency feature that is designed to reduce loud environmental noise without blocking out all sound.

Apple's 80% Charging Limit for iPhone: How Much Did It Help After a Year?

Tuesday September 24, 2024 2:09 pm PDT by
With the iPhone 15 models that came out last year, Apple added an opt-in battery setting that limits maximum charge to 80 percent. The idea is that never charging the iPhone above 80 percent will increase battery longevity, so I kept my iPhone at that 80 percent limit from September 2023 to now, with no cheating. My iPhone 15 Pro Max battery level is currently at 94 percent with 299 cycles....
